What the score means

The score is relative auction value, not a cash prediction. A high score means the chair is allowed to get expensive. A low score means you should be hunting a different podium. Base low overalls score like fuel. Secret high overalls score like endgame. Rainbow can outscore Diamond even at a similar overall because the studio framed Rainbow as a spectacle chase, which also means more bid pressure. Pressure is not the same as income. If the live room is feral, a high score still walks.

When the checker lies

It lies when you lie to it. If you mark a card Secret because it looks shiny, the score inflates. If you ignore that rebirth will wipe the collection, a high score is a trap, and the rebirth tutorial wins the argument. If the server is empty, even a mid score can be a gift because nobody else is punching. Table context still matters. The map helps you find quieter chairs.

Mutations, sold as a 249 Robux 2X chance pass, can make a face look rarer than the dropdown admits. If a card is mutated, treat it as at least one frame above its printed border until you have watched it print. Then come back and score it honestly. The variants page is still Gold, Diamond, Rainbow, Secret. Mutations ride on top. Do not invent a fifth dropdown because a pass exists.

Is a higher score always a buy?

No. Score says the card can be valuable. Cash and opponents decide whether it is purchasable.

Why does overall change the score?

Official art treats 90, 92, 103, and infinite stats as different objects. The tool respects that ladder.

Should I check every C-tier card?

Early on, yes, until you can eyeball fuel. Later, only check chairs that might be upgrades.
